Verisk Reports First-Quarter 2025 Financial Results
VeriskVerisk(US:VRSK) Globenewswireยท2025-05-07 11:15

Core Insights - Verisk reported strong financial results for Q1 2025, with a revenue increase of 7.0% year-over-year, reaching $753 million, and organic constant currency revenue growth of 7.9% [5][8][16] - The company achieved a net income of $232 million, reflecting a 5.9% increase compared to the previous year, and an adjusted EBITDA of $417 million, up 9.5% [3][10][17] - Verisk returned over $250 million to shareholders through dividends and share repurchases, demonstrating confidence in its business model and financial strength [3][23] Financial Performance - Revenues for Q1 2025 were $753 million, up from $704 million in Q1 2024, marking a 7.0% increase [5][8] - Net income increased to $232 million from $219 million, a rise of 5.9% [10][40] - Adjusted EBITDA reached $417 million, up 9.5% from $380 million in the same quarter last year [10][11] - Diluted EPS attributable to Verisk was $1.65, an increase of 8.6% from $1.52 [13][40] - Free cash flow grew by 23.3% to $391 million, compared to $317 million in Q1 2024 [15][56] Segment Performance - Underwriting revenues increased by 6.8% to $532 million, with organic constant currency growth of 7.2% [7][16] - Claims revenues grew by 7.5% to $221 million, with organic constant currency growth of 9.6% [7][16] Shareholder Returns - The company returned over $250 million to shareholders through dividends and share repurchases [3][23] - The dividend per share was increased to $0.45, up 15.4% from $0.39 [5][15] 2025 Financial Guidance - Verisk reiterated its financial guidance for 2025, projecting total revenue between $3.03 billion and $3.08 billion, and adjusted EBITDA between $1.67 billion and $1.72 billion [18]
